Transaction e93ffb607f0e464ea19e9eeb592c7b41b8ab21150500251ba23180ef43cc7c9e
1 Input
1 Output
-
e93ffb607f0e464ea19e9eeb592c7b41b8ab21150500251ba23180ef43cc7c9e:0
- value
- 2636777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b5d9163a4abb4084b7d78c57566e6b164f7f49c OP_EQUAL
- address
- 3Qc7cuYRVfJ8eFE7deE9xVoPgyecXErqB9